Indiana
Virginia A. Franklin Smith Indiana Franklin was born in Bedford County, TN August 08, 1830. Her
mother ( but possibly grandmother) was Rachael Franklin. Her father is
unproven, but believed to be Peter Franklin. We have only tied her to one
sibling –
Lucinda Franklin Burt. There were others, as yet unknown. Like
Lucinda’s records show, her father was born in VA and her mother in NC,
although one record says SC. Lorenzo Smith was born July 22, 1824 in TN. His parents were Rev.
Joseph Smith and Elizabeth Shasteen of Moore County, TN. The 1860 TN Census of Franklin
County lists: SMITH, Lorenzo A., 35, Indiana
E. 29, Robert F. 9, Joseph H. 6, John L., 1 Rachael Franklin is enumerated
with them. She was enumerated with Alfred Burt and Lucinda Franklin Burt in
1850 another census. The 1880 TX Census of Denton
County lists: Luerenzo Smith 56 Farmer, B TN,
Father B SC Mother B SC Virginia , wife, 50, B TN,
Father B VA, Mother B NC John 21, Son Emily 17, Dau Unreadable but maybe Watson(??)
14 Son Unreadable but maybe James (??)
7 This Lorenzo A. is definitely
the same person. Indiana is obviously Virginia. I don’t know why her name is
different. Was Indiana a nickname? John was still living at home in 1880.

click to enlarge photo Oak Grove Cemetery – 10 miles East of Denton on State Highway 380, turn South on FM 720 (Sign across road says Oak Grove Lane with arrow pointing North, and FM 720 with arrow pointing South). Located on the East side of the road, about .2 mile, at the Oak Grove United Methodist Church.
